The Crown Prince affirms to the Iranian President: We will not allow our airspace to be used militarily

His Royal Highness Prince Mohammed bin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ud, Crown Prince and Prime Minister, received a telephone call today from President Masoud Pezeshkian of the Islamic Republic of Iran. The call addressed bilateral relations and the latest developments in the region. This call comes at a sensitive time for the Middle East, reflecting the importance of continued communication between the leaderships of the two countries to ensure de-escalation and prevent further escalation in the region.
During the call, His Royal Highness the Crown Prince reaffirmed the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ia’s firm and principled stance of respecting the sovereignty of nations, emphasizing unequivocally that the Kingdom will not permit the use of its airspace or territory to carry out any military actions or attacks against the Islamic Republic of Iran, regardless of who is behind such attacks. This position reflects the Kingdom’s longstanding policy of non-interference in direct military conflicts and its commitment to not being a party to or a conduit for any operations that could threaten regional security.
In the context of expanding the background of this event, this communication is an extension of the path of de-escalation and restoration of diplomatic relations between Riyadh and Tehran, which was launched under the agreement sponsored by China in March 2023. This agreement resulted in the return of ambassadors and the resumption of cooperation in multiple fields, as the Kingdom seeks, through these diplomatic moves, to strengthen the pillars of stability in the region in a way that serves its ambitious development vision (Vision 2030), which requires a safe and stable regional environment far from geopolitical tensions.
During the call, the Iranian president also addressed the latest developments within Iran, outlining his government's efforts to address current challenges, in addition to discussing the progress of negotiations concerning the Iranian nuclear program. In this regard, His Royal Highness the Crown Prince reiterated the Kingdom's support for all efforts aimed at resolving disputes through dialogue and peaceful means, emphasizing that security and stability are the strategic imperative for the countries and peoples of the region.
For his part, President Masoud Pezeshkian expressed his deep gratitude and appreciation to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ia and its leadership for this clear and supportive stance regarding Iran's sovereignty and territorial integrity. The Iranian president also commended the pivotal role played by His Royal Highness the Crown Prince in leading de-escalation efforts and his tireless endeavors to achieve international peace and security, reflecting the Kingdom's significant political and diplomatic influence on both the regional and international stages.
